Installing the libtool port allowed dovecot2-sieve to compile and install. I will see about adding a trac ticket.
Thanks, -Terry On May 25, 2012, at 4:54 PM, Terry Barnum wrote: > I'm not sure what I'm doing wrong but I can't get the dovecot2-sieve port to > install. It fails during configuring. I've tried sudo port clean > dovecot2-sieve. Macports is up to date, XCode 4.2, 10.6.8, Intel iMac, > dovecot2 is installed. It installs fine on another iMac so it's got to be a > configuration thing on my part but I don't know what.
